  5. Check the file system of the drive. Open File Explorer. Right-click the drive and choose Properties. On the General tab, next to File system, see if it says NTFS. If the file system is FAT or FAT32, refer to the next section. Otherwise, proceed to Unlink OneDrive and run OneDrive setup again.
